Set up your Health app

Before you can use your Health application, it is important that you add your information. To do this, follow the steps below:

Step 1: Open the Health App.

Step 2: Click Health Data tab.

Step 3: Tap account icon on the top-right of the screen.

Step 4: Add Your information.
Adding data from other applications
Checking if any apps work with Health:

Step 1: Open Health.

Step 2: Click Sources tab.

Step 3: Tap any app.

Adding new applications:

Step 1: Open Health.

Step 2: Click Health Data tab.

Step 3: Tap a specific category. For example, Mindfulness.

Step 4: Download a recommended app for tracking the selected category.

Step 5: Install the application. Set the app up.

Step 6: Open your Health application, click the Sources tab, and then tap the downloaded application. Turn the categories you wish to track on.
How to Fix iPhone Health App not Tracking Steps?

There are several reasons that may lead to the iPhone Health app not counting steps issue. To help you fix this, we have outlined several possible solutions. Just start with the first solution. If it does not work, move on to the next.

Method 1: Turn the Health app on in the Privacy Settings

Maybe the reason your Health app is not counting steps is that it is turned off in the device privacy settings. You can fix this by following the steps below:

Step 1: Open Settings on your iPhone.

Step 2: Open Privacy.

Step 3: Open Motion & Fitness.

Step 4: Toggle Health on.



Check if the issue is fixed by walking and checking whether the app is counting steps.
Method 2: Reboot your device

If your iPhone has a software bug, your Health app will not count steps. In most cases, rebooting your iPhone can fix this. To reboot your device, just turn it off and then on. Check again to see if your Health app is counting steps. If it does not, move on to the next solution.
Method 3: Make sure Health data can be shown on your dashboard

In some cases, the Health application may be collecting data but it is not being shown on the dashboard. To fix this, follow the steps below:

Step 1: Open your Health application, navigate to the bottom and choose Health Data.

Step 2: Choose Fitness and then click Walking + Running Distance.

Step 3: Toggle on Show on Dashboard.



Check your dashboard to see if you can see your steps now. If not, try the following method.
